OpenAI Granted Access by Associated Press for Training on Articles

The Associated Press and OpenAI have formed a partnership that allows OpenAI to train its AI on news articles. This collaboration provides AP with an opportunity to explore new applications of AI, while also enhancing OpenAI’s language models. The partnership between the Associated Press and OpenAI was announced on June 13, 2023. In a joint statement, the companies revealed that OpenAI will license a portion of AP’s text archive, while AP will have access to OpenAI’s technology and product expertise. The press release emphasized that both parties value intellectual property and support a framework that protects it. OpenAI will be able to access AP news stories dating back to 1995, which will be instrumental in training its ChatGPT language model.

This collaboration is beneficial for both AP and OpenAI. OpenAI can utilize AP’s vast collection of news stories to train its AI systems, while also safeguarding its access to valuable material in the face of potential lawsuits. On the other hand, AP can leverage OpenAI’s technology and expertise to enhance its products and services. By signing licensing deals with reputable sources like AP, OpenAI can ensure legal access to the content it needs.

The implications of this partnership for journalism are significant. Some individuals worry that AI could replace jobs, particularly in the field of journalism, where chatbots could potentially generate news articles in seconds. OpenAI CEO Sam Altman expressed his concerns about these advancements, acknowledging that humanity has historically adapted to technological shifts. However, he also fears that the pace of AI development may outpace our ability to adapt.

Nevertheless, the Media Diversity Institute suggests that AI’s rise in journalism emphasizes the importance of journalists themselves. If more publications rely on AI-generated content, the internet could become saturated with artificial intelligence. AI models could run out of human-generated text to reference, leading them to rely on unreliable and malicious sources. This would make it difficult for people to find accurate and trustworthy information online.

In this age of AI, journalists play a vital role in providing valuable and reliable news. Journalists are essential for storytelling, contextualizing history, and presenting complex narratives that go beyond simplistic interpretations. As AI continues to advance, the skills and expertise of journalists will become increasingly valued.
